Citizens' Assembly calls for stronger reconciliation efforts to support the country's EU integration

FENA Alma Zukanović, Photo: Harun Muminović

SARAJEVO, July 2 (FENA) – Building and strengthening trust in post-conflict societies are the key prerequisites for social development, which is why Key Priority 5 of the European Commission's Opinion, relating to reconciliation and overcoming the legacy of the past, can be regarded as the fundamental precondition for fulfilling all other priorities.
